सांस्कृतिक पृष्ठभूमि

The phrase is deeply rooted in the Nuremberg Code and the Helsinki Declaration, which were created to prevent human rights abuses in research. It reflects a Western cultural emphasis on individual autonomy and the legal right to self-determination. Today, it is a mandatory phrase in almost every scientific publication involving human subjects.

What It Means

Informed consent was secured is a heavy-duty phrase from the world of research and medicine. It tells the reader that nobody was tricked into participating. The word informed means the person had all the necessary information. Consent means they said a clear "yes." Secured is a fancy way of saying the researchers successfully obtained that agreement, usually in writing. It is the gold standard for ethical behavior.

How To Use It

You will mostly use this in professional writing or academic reports. It usually appears in the 'Methodology' section of a paper. You are basically telling your audience, "Don't worry, I followed the rules and treated people with respect." You can use it as a standalone sentence to confirm ethical compliance. It sounds very official and final.

When To Use It

Use this when you are writing a thesis, a medical report, or a formal business case study. If you interviewed people for a project, this phrase protects you. It shows you are a professional who respects privacy and autonomy. It is perfect for situations where legal or ethical standards are being checked. Think of it as your "ethical shield."

When NOT To Use It

Do not use this at a dinner party or on a first date. If you ask your friend, "Was informed consent secured before I ate your fries?" they will think you are a robot. It is way too cold for personal relationships. Avoid it in casual emails or text messages unless you are making a very specific joke about being overly formal. It sounds strange in any context that isn't academic or clinical.

Cultural Background

This phrase grew out of a dark history of medical experiments where people were hurt without knowing why. After World War II, the world decided we needed strict rules to protect human rights. Now, in Western culture, informed consent is a sacred concept. It represents the shift from doctors being "bosses" to patients being "partners." It is a cornerstone of modern ethics and law.

Common Variations

  • Participants provided informed consent (Active voice, sounds more direct)
  • Obtained informed consent (Very common in medical charts)
  • Signed consent forms were collected (More literal and physical)
  • Prior informed consent (Emphasizes that the 'yes' came before the action)

The 'Informed' Part is Key

In English-speaking cultures, just saying 'yes' isn't enough. If the person didn't understand the risks, the consent is considered invalid.
